Keeping a pet within a council home in Bournemouth

Note: This information is only for council tenants in Bournemouth properties. If you’re a council tenant in a Poole property, please visit the PHP website.

We’re happy for our tenants to keep pets, but you must ask us first.  

We need to check that you’re able to keep your chosen pets responsibly, without causing problems for other residents.  

Sometimes, before we give permission to keep a pet, we’ll ask you to get suitable home insurance to cover the cost of any damage the pet may cause.  

There are some further limits to keeping pets if you live in senior living accommodation.  

If you cannot look after your pet in a way that meets the terms of your tenancy agreement, we may decide you can no longer keep it at the property.  

You must take full responsibility for any pets you have, as we accept no liability for pets living in our properties.  

Apply to keep a pet in your council home  

Complete our Pet Policy Application Form and return it to us before you get a pet.
